Faking it

Yesterday was the start of International Fake Journal Month. It took me forever to come up with a game plan. At the nth hour I decided to work in a square format, watercolor paper, and to paint only birds and botanicals. And since I rarely use gouache, this seems like a good time to incorporate that into the mix as well - it's not my real journal so it doesn't matter, right?  Remember:  Life is short, why live only one?

    Anna -- Google International Fake Journal Month. Basically you create a journal that is not typical of your usual style. I never use gouache, for example, but for one month I will. I usually add words, this month I won't. I usually just draw anything, this month it's only birds and botanicals. I don't typically add a background, this month I will. Some people take on a different personal but I haven't gone that route.
